Repairing uneven or cracked concrete removes trip hazards and creates smoother, safer walking areas around your property.
Professional repairs restore stability to slabs, steps, patios, and driveways that have developed cracks or surface damage.
Early repairs protect your investment by preventing cracks and spalling from spreading across the surface.

We assess cracks, spalling, and structural surface damage to determine the correct repair method.
Our team selects the best approach, such as crack injection, concrete patching, or structural repair.
Damaged areas are repaired using quality materials and proper surface preparation for long lasting results.

Structural crack repair systems restore the internal strength of damaged concrete surfaces.
Grinding and cleaning ensure repair materials bond properly with existing concrete surfaces.
Polymer modified mortars, bonding agents, and epoxy fillers create reliable structural repairs.
